UPSSSC Lekhpal PET result 2026 released at upsssc.gov.in: Direct link to download scorecards here

The Uttar Pradesh Subordinate Services Selection Commission (UPSSSC) has officially released the Preliminary Eligibility Test 2025 (PET 2025) result for the Lekhpal recruitment examination. Candidates who appeared for PET 2025 can now check and download their scorecards from the official website upsssc. gov. in.

According to the official notification, the result has been declared under Advertisement No. 02-Examination/2025, related to the Lekhpal Main Examination (P.A.O./A.O.-2025)/01. The recruitment drive is being conducted to fill a total of 7,994 vacant posts of Revenue Lekhpal under the control of the Revenue Council, Uttar Pradesh, Lucknow.

The commission has clarified that candidates who appeared in PET 2025 and obtained actual (absolute) scores or normalized scores were considered for shortlisting. Wherever applicable, the higher of the two scores was taken into account. The result has been prepared strictly on the basis of normalized scores to ensure fairness across different exam shifts.

As per the rules, candidates were shortlisted in the ratio of 15 times the total number of vacancies, including all candidates who secured equal cut-off marks in their respective categories.

Based on this calculation, the commission has recommended 3,66,712 candidates for the Lekhpal Main Examination.

The cut-off marks and results of all shortlisted candidates have been uploaded on the official website on 26 February 2026. Candidates are advised to note that the date of the Lekhpal Main Examination will be announced separately through a fresh notice on the commission’s website.

How to check UPSSSC Lekhpal PET result 2026

Follow the steps below to check the scorecard:

  • Visit the official website at upsssc. gov. in

  • Go to the homepage and click on the PET 2025 result link

  • Enter the required login details

  • View your result and cut-off marks

  • Download and save the scorecard for future use

Candidates should carefully verify all details mentioned on the scorecard. The PET score is mandatory for appearing in the Main Examination and will be used for further stages of the recruitment process.

For further updates on the Lekhpal Main Examination schedule and further instructions, candidates are advised to regularly check the official website of Uttar Pradesh Subordinate Services Selection Commission.
